How Much Does Commercial Construction Cost in Phoenix?
Phoenix carries a regional cost multiplier of approximately 0.92–1.05x versus the national average — making it one of the most cost-competitive major metros in the country for commercial construction. Phoenix is significantly more affordable than coastal markets like San Francisco (1.25–1.40x) or New York (1.35–1.50x), and comparable to other Sun Belt hubs like Dallas (0.88–1.00x) and Atlanta (0.92–1.02x).
Phoenix construction costs by type: Warehouses $75–$150/SF. Offices $140–$330/SF. Restaurants $190–$400/SF. Medical $190–$480/SF. Veterinary clinics $190–$480/SF. Self storage $24–$115/NRSF. Tenant improvements $28–$480/SF depending on use. Data centers $300–$1,200/SF. Manufacturing $95–$480/SF. Cold storage $125–$310/SF.
Key Phoenix-specific cost factors include caliche soil (a calcium carbonate hardpan requiring pneumatic breakers or specialized excavation, adding $3–$15/SF for site prep), extreme heat scheduling (summer concrete pours require early morning starts, admixtures, and curing protection — adding 5–10% to concrete costs June–September), oversized HVAC loads (Phoenix has among the highest cooling degree days in the U.S., requiring 25–40% larger mechanical systems than temperate climates), and City of Phoenix/Maricopa County permitting (typically 4–10 weeks for commercial). Summer temperatures exceeding 115°F create significant construction constraints. Concrete pours require early morning starts (often 3–5 AM), hot-weather admixtures, and curing protection — adding 5–10% to concrete costs June through September. Worker productivity drops and OSHA heat illness prevention protocols require additional hydration breaks. TCG's construction management team schedules heat-sensitive work in cooler months when possible and implements aggressive heat mitigation for summer construction.
Caliche is a calcium carbonate hardpan layer found throughout the Phoenix metro at varying depths. It cannot be excavated with standard equipment — requiring pneumatic breakers, rock saws, or blasting in extreme cases. Caliche adds $3–$15/SF to site preparation costs depending on depth and density. A geotechnical report is essential for any Phoenix project. Phoenix has among the highest cooling degree days of any U.S. metro — commercial HVAC systems must be 25–40% larger than those in temperate climates. This significantly affects both capital cost and long-term energy expenses. Yes — Phoenix is one of the fastest-growing data center markets in the U.S., driven by competitive APS and SRP power rates, abundant land, low natural disaster risk (no hurricanes, minimal seismic activity), and proximity to West Coast markets via fiber. Major cloud providers and colocation operators are actively expanding in the West Valley and Chandler corridors.
